Several white nationalists across the country have said they plan to monitor the polls across the state.

Jeff Schoep, leader of the Nationalist Socialist Party, speaks with Here & Now's Robin Young about his perspective on the election and his goals to "defend the rights of white people" and ultimately secede from the United States.
